Preston men charged as part of major human trafficking operation

Two Preston men have this evening (April 20) been charged as part of a major human trafficking operation.

Razvan Mitru, 30, of Arkwright Road, Preston and Traian Gvarila, 31, of Victoria Place, Preston are among eight people charged with conspiring to traffic for sexual exploitation and conspiring to incite prostitution for gain.

They are all due to appear before Blackburn Magistrates Court tomorrow morning (April 21).

The charges follow a long running proactive investigation led by Lancashire Constabulary’s human trafficking and modern slavery team Op Proteus, a dedicated team working to identify both the victims and perpetrators of trafficking and slavery across Lancashire.

Seven men and one woman were arrested following a series of early morning raids on Wednesday (April 19) that included Preston, Blackburn and Blackpool.

Full list of those charged:

Razvan Mitru, 30, of Arkwright Road, Preston

Ionut Dogaru, 28, of Whitebirk Road, Blackburn

Alexandru Baltoiu, 24, of St Margaret’s Road, Evesham

Marius Trasca, 29, of Watt Street, Gateshead

Marian Diaconu, 25, of Arborfield Close, Slough

Andra Amzulin, 27, of Station Road, Blackpool

Claudiu-Nicusor Vlaescu, 31, of Whitebirk Road, Blackburn

Traian Gvarila, 31, of Victoria Place, Preston
